Stuffed Bell Peppers (Classic Ukrainian Recipe)
Stuffed bell peppers are a great way to enjoy one of the most flavorful veggies. Stuffed with a savory mixture of beef and buckwheat, these peppers are sure to satisfy.

Ingredients
- 1 lb thinly sliced beef
- 3 large bell peppers
- 1 lb mushrooms sliced
- 1 large onion
- 2 cup diced carrots
- 2 cups cooked buckwheat
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 1 tsp pepper adjust to taste
- 1 tbsp salt adjust to taste
Instructions
- Slice the bell pepper into two pieces. Remove the seeds from the pepper. Dice carrots and onions into small squares.
- Cut beef into small, thin pieces. Preheat oiled skillet on high heat. Cook beef until it gets a golden color. Remove from the skillet and set aside.
- In the same skillet, sautee carrots and onions until they soften. Add sliced mushrooms and continue cooking until all the ingredients are golden.
- Add buckwheat and beef to the skillet, season with salt and pepper. Stir to combine everything together.
- Fill each one of the peppers with the cooked buckwheat filling.
- Bake for 35 minutes at 370F. Place slice of cheese on each pepper, cook for another 5 minutes or until cheese is melted.
